CNN was forced to abruptly cut to a commercial break after anchor Wolf Blitzer appeared to be on the verge of vomiting during a live interview with White House Oversight Committee Ranking Member Jamie Raskin. The "Situation Room" host was in the middle of the interview on Thursday night when he became visibly uncomfortable and appeared to be repeatedly chocking something back. He looked on in increasingly panicked silence as Mr Raskin talked about the dispute in Colorado over Donald Trump's appearance on the ballot. 

Mr Blitzer, 75, struggled to contain himself for a full minute before CNN cut his feed and left Mr Ruskin to finish his final comments on his own. At this point, attentive listeners could hear vomit-like sounds in the background. CNN then abruptly played a commercial, cutting Mr Ruskin off mid-sentence.

The show eventually returned but with CNN chief legal affairs correspondent Paula Reid as the host. "Wolf had to step away, he'll be back," Ms Reid said before continuing with the show. 

In a statement to the Washington Post, CNN confirmed that Mr Wolf "wasn't feeling 100% while anchoring Thursday night". "He looks forward to being back in the Situation Room and appreciates the well wishes," the network stated.
